On minimal Legendrian submanifolds of Sasaki-Einstein manifolds
arXiv:1404.2467 · doi:10.1142/S0129167X14500839
Abstract
For a given minimal Legendrian submanifold of a Sasaki-Einstein manifold we construct two families of eigenfunctions of the Laplacian of and we give a lower bound for the dimension of the corresponding eigenspace. Moreover, in the case the lower bound is attained, we prove that is totally geodesic and a rigidity result about the ambient manifold. This is a generalization of a result for the standard Sasakian sphere done by Lê and Wang.
